Output 52c6d2119aeb562c2ab0f02388d5bece9a14670b40005e7528a7db1cf17a9c03:13

value
42959427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30bb6295e2336d24d66c209b1b2e95ae60f85f61 OP_EQUAL
address
MCLq9PAidxmtDs2psyWqfQ7HsUcE1thr2Z
transaction
52c6d2119aeb562c2ab0f02388d5bece9a14670b40005e7528a7db1cf17a9c03
spent
true